My wife and I tried a moulding kit. It is not as simple as it seems. After cutting the plastic tube to the correct length and mixing the mould you have to put your penis in the mixture. The trick is to not only maintain an erection but to keep your penis in the middle of the tube so it doesn't hit the sides of it. Not as easy as it sounds. After you make the mould you need to fill it with the liquid rubber asap. We didn't know this and went to pour in the rubber the next day and the mould had dried out and shrivelled. We have yet to try it again.
